Pakistan needs a spy satellite?

The ECNEC approved the project of Pakistan Remote Sensing Satellite (PRSS) located in Sindh and Punjab with the cost of Rs1,9695 million.

The project is part of the National Satellite Development Programme for space technology and its application will be in Pakistan, institutional capacity building of Suparco and relevant organisations. The project will carry optical pay load that will produce high resolution earth images with stereo capabilities. The image quality produced by PRSS would be in accordance with the defined international standards.
